Quayside sits on the banks of the River Deben and is made up of three detached properties:  the main house which we occupy (Ged, Donna and Stuart Morgan), and two self-catering cottages: Quayside Cottage and The Boathouse.

Quayside Cottage is a detached bungalow, with river views from the cottage and garden. It provides ground floor accommodation of separate sitting room, conservatory, kitchen, double bedroom (with standard size double bed) with en-suite shower room and separate w.c., making it suitable for people with limited mobility who prefer not to or cannot use stairs (storage is provided - with advance notice please - for a motorised scooter, and battery charging facility is provided in the bike store adjoining the rear of Quayside Cottage - shared use with The Boathouse).  However, the cottage is not suitable for a wheelchair due to limited space to manoeuvre inside, and loose gravel driveway with a slight incline to the designated parking. Guests using a motorised scooter will also not find this surface suitable and so should only expect to use a scooter outside of Quayside property.

Whilst this property is not designed for disabled use, it does subtly cater for those with limited mobility with the provision of two hand rails within the cottage:  one inside the entrance porch, to the left of the front door; the other inside the spacious shower cubicle, on the right as you step in.  The floor surface is level throughout, with all door thresholds being flush with the flooring (with the exception of a 3cm raise between the conservatory and sitting room and 3cm raise over the front door threshold).  There is one step from the entrance door into the porch, one step from the front door into the hall, one step from the conservatory onto paving and one step from paving onto garden lawn (step rise from 65-180mm). 

The cottage is all electric, with modern wall-mounted convector heaters fitted to each room (apart from the wc); underfloor heating and electric towel rail in the shower room; coal-effect stove fire set in a brick fireplace recess in the sitting room, plus satellite/tv/radio/cd/dvd; and kitchen appliances include low-level oven incorporating grill, ceramic (knob control) hob and extractor hood, microwave oven, under unit fridge with freezer box, cordless kettle and toaster.  Wireless broadband facility is available - access key provided in cottage.

The Boathouse is a two-storey building.  Please note that the stairs make it unsuitable for those with limited mobility.  5-star rated and Gold Award 2009/2010.  

River views from the first-floor balcony and also via the tv which is tuned to receive camera footage from Quayside waterfront (so you can still watch the boats passing by when you are indoors).  Guests also have waterfront seating here at Quayside, where you can enjoy panoramic views in both directions of the river.  Distance via garden footpath from The Boathouse patio to the waterfront is approximately 25 metres.

This is open-plan accommodation, leading from kitchen, to dining, to sitting area.  The bathroom is positioned off the entrance hall for extra privacy and provides both bath and separate spacious shower cubicle.  The staircase is open tread and leads straight into the first-floor double bedroom with standard size double bed.  This is a bright and spacious room with vaulted ceiling and windows to all elevations.  Additional entry/exit from the bedroom is provided via an external staircase and balcony, accessed via french doors.

Heating is via underfloor oil-fired central heating to the ground floor and radiator to the first floor; heated towel rail to the bathroom; all electric kitchen appliances, including low-level oven, ceramic (knob control) hob and extractor fan, microwave oven, cordless kettle, toaster, dishwasher and full-size fridge and freezer compartment.  Lighting is spotlights, wall and table lamps.  Dining area with rustic dining table and bench seating, plus cosy electric, log-effect, stove heater.  Wired broadband connection.
